EU Exports to Russia Down to 37% of Prewar Level, News
Since the start of the war in Ukraine in spring 2022, EU exports to Russia have fallen to 37% of their prewar level. “One reason for the still high volume of exports to Russia is that only 32% of all products from the EU are subject to sanctions,“ notes ifo-expert Feodora Teti.
